I created a zap to connect two Notion databases. When an item is added to database A, create a new term in database B. The time zone is default in both databases. But when the Zap runs, it changes the timezone in database B from PST to EST so my items always show in the day before the date entered in A. Does anyone encounter the same issue? Thanks!

Hi Todd,
Thank you for your reply! I figured it out by myself. I just included “timezone” property in the Action step (with “include time” set as True) and it works!
